// SPDX-License-Identifier: CC0-1.0

//! SHA384 implementation.

use core::ops::Index;
use core::slice::SliceIndex;
use core::str;

use crate::{sha512, FromSliceError};

crate::internal_macros::hash_type! {
384,
false,
"Output of the SHA384 hash function."
}

fn from_engine(e: HashEngine) -> Hash {
let mut ret = [0; 48];
ret.copy_from_slice(&sha512::from_engine(e.0)[..48]);
Hash(ret)
}

/// Engine to compute SHA384 hash function.
#[derive(Clone)]
pub struct HashEngine(sha512::HashEngine);

impl Default for HashEngine {
#[rustfmt::skip]
fn default() -> Self {
HashEngine(sha512::HashEngine::sha384())
}
}

impl crate::HashEngine for HashEngine {
type MidState = [u8; 64];

fn midstate(&self) -> [u8; 64] { self.0.midstate() }

const BLOCK_SIZE: usize = sha512::BLOCK_SIZE;

fn n_bytes_hashed(&self) -> usize { self.0.n_bytes_hashed() }

fn input(&mut self, inp: &[u8]) { self.0.input(inp); }
}

/// Constructs a hash engine suitable for use inside the default `sha384::HashEngine`.
#[rustfmt::skip]
pub(crate) fn sha384() -> Self {
HashEngine {
h: [
0xcbbb9d5dc1059ed8, 0x629a292a367cd507, 0x9159015a3070dd17, 0x152fecd8f70e5939,
0x67332667ffc00b31, 0x8eb44a8768581511, 0xdb0c2e0d64f98fa7, 0x47b5481dbefa4fa4,
],
length: 0,
buffer: [0; BLOCK_SIZE],
}
}
}
